What companies run services between Ravda, Bulgaria and Sofia, Bulgaria?

Kaleia operates a bus from Pomorie to Sofia once daily. Tickets cost $45–70 and the journey takes 4h 45m. Alternatively, Bulgarian Railways (BDZh) operates a train from Burgas to Sofia 5 times a day. Tickets cost $12–21 and the journey takes 5h 55m.
